Just over 12 months ago (June 2006), we brought you news of
a (then!) super-bright LED whose brightness exceeded that of a 20W halogen. With
rapid advancements in the LED field, the next brightness hurdle – that of
the 50W halogen – has been jumped.
Osram has developed a light-emitting diode (LED) spotlight that
achieves an output of more than 1000 lumens. That’s brighter than a 50W halogen
lamp, making the device suitable for a broad range of general lighting
applications. The Ostar Lighting LED, scheduled for release within months, can
provide sufficient light for a desk from a height of two metres, for example.
Its small size also enables the creation of completely new lamp shapes.
